Hi. I am a sixty four year old woman who is on Doxacosin 2 mg and Atenolol 75 mgs. I have been having episodes of shivering and feeling very cold in the mornings after taking Doxacosin and Atenolol at night. My doctor has started me on a regime of lowering my dosage of Atenolol to,see if that helps but still getting the chills. Could this be caused by the Doxacosin. I have tried Ace inhibitors and channel blockers too but they did not reduce my blood pressure. Please can you help.
